Transaction ec3295a7e33c60fe50bbfddb1e5d2561ba4671ebabc6181f12883ff5403ca15e
1 Input
1 Output
-
ec3295a7e33c60fe50bbfddb1e5d2561ba4671ebabc6181f12883ff5403ca15e:0
- value
- 4300385
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ca059b1e9fab60e9db38cf7a0f3236801b35652
- address
- ltc1qrjs9nv0fl2mqa8dn3nm6puerdqqmx4jje0unfl